Account-Based Marketing Manager , NAMER Strategic Customer and Partner Marketing
About the role
AWS is seeking an Account-Based Marketing (ABM) Manager to design and execute high-impact ABM programs for enterprise customers within a designated field territory. This role combines strategic thinking with hands-on execution to drive measurable business outcomes through targeted marketing initiatives.
Key Responsibilities
Design and execute territory-specific ABM campaigns (1:1, 1:few) that align with global frameworks and drive measurable business impact
Build and maintain strong relationships with sales teams to understand account priorities and translate them into effective marketing programs
Analyze customer data, buying signals, and market trends to inform campaign strategy and optimization
Create and implement multi-channel programs (events, digital, direct) that deliver personalized customer experiences
Partner with regional marketing teams to ensure ABM programs complement broader field marketing efforts
Drive operational excellence through standardized processes, documentation, and best practices
Track and report on program performance, using data to optimize and scale successful approaches
Manage program budgets effectively, demonstrating frugality while maximizing impact
Collaborate with global ABM community to share learnings and adopt proven practices
